With a mass of about 9.10938215×10−31 kg. (0.510998910 MeV), electrons are not known to be formed of anything smaller than themselves. They are thus, elementary particles.

Absolutely. An electron has a mass of 9.109 382 15.E-31 kg.

That is .0000000000000000000000000000911kg.

The mass of the proton is 1.672E-27 kg.

The mass of the neutron is slightly larger at 1.674E-27 kg.
